Find the values of x and y from the following pair of linear equations :
62x + 43y = 167
43x + 62y = 148
(x = 2, y = 1)
62x + 43y = 167 …(i)
43x + 62y = 148 …(ii)
Adding (i) and (ii) and simplifying, we get x + y = 3 …(iii)
Subtracting (ii) from (i) and simplifying, we get x − y = 1 …(iv)
Solving (iii) and (iv) to get x = 2 and y = 1
